Viewing IP Connectivity
The 'IP Connectivity' page displays online, read-only network diagnostic connectivity
information on all destination IP addresses configured in the 'Outbound IP Routing Table'
page (refer to ''Configuring the Outbound IP Routing Table''

The IP address can be one of the following:
IP address defined as the destination IP address in the 'Outbound IP
Routing Table'.
IP address resolved from the host name defined as the destination IP
address in the 'Outbound IP Routing Table'.
Host name (or IP address) as defined in the 'Outbound IP Routing Table'.
The method according to which the destination IP address is queried
periodically (ICMP ping or SIP OPTIONS request).
